A Providence City Council committee voted Jan. 14 to grant an electrical easement to Narragansett Electric Company (d/b/a Rhode Island Energy) over city land at 254 Eastwood Ave. to allow installation of a transformer needed for an ongoing school rebuild, city staff said.
